Environment » Sustainability » Sustainability in schools » Ecobuzz
Ecobuzz is produced each term by Nelson City Council and Tasman District Council. This electronic and hard copy mag is designed be a useful resource for teachers and students alike, with information on different topics, events and competitions each term.
